Transaction 98279ece605a04009e8faa1c5648f3baca714a264db54ae25b32ab76d96b6d75
1 Input
1 Output
-
98279ece605a04009e8faa1c5648f3baca714a264db54ae25b32ab76d96b6d75:0
- value
- 3972926
- script pubkey
- OP_0 OP_PUSHBYTES_32 2151812246e8b50c19eb8cb896688a52289b0d3c0ea625402bcf48e6dcd4f264
- address
- bc1qy9gczgjxaz6scx0t3jufv6y22g5fkrfup6nz2spteaywdhx57fjqjhjt4x